This Rockford home had been in the family for years, and the floor plan had never quite kept up with how the family had grown. The original layout left them short on space for everyday life, and a detached garage that sat mostly empty was taking up a yard they couldn’t fully use. They wanted something functional and connected — a main-floor addition that gave them room to breathe without making the home feel like it had been pieced together over time. The challenge was expanding the footprint in a way that respected the original structure and still felt cohesive from the street.
The finished addition gave the family a generous family room, a dedicated workspace, and a mudroom entry that finally made coming and going feel easy. Materials were matched carefully to the existing home so the transition between old and new is nearly invisible. Storage that never existed before is now built into the design, and the connection to the backyard the family had always wanted is now a real part of daily life. What was once a cramped, frustrating layout has become a home that genuinely fits the way they live — with room for what matters now and flexibility for what comes next.
